Edited 19 days agoHaving a separate release for the 'Qadpuss' release is nonsensical - it should be included with 'Close To Me' in my opinion.
This specific release is part of the 1985 'Close To Me' release cycle in the U.K. It does bear a Fic 23 catalogue number variant after all.
The North American market did something different with 'Close To Me / A Night Like This' and I believe this release should at least be separated for that reason.
Notice too that the Elektra 7" releases bear a later catalogue number than that of Quadpus. This suggests a completely different release schedule and strategy in that market.

Edited one year agoFrom 1986, 2 tracks from Head On The Door, and two previously unreleased; overall, rather dancey, with horns.
Recording quality is excellent, with good mix and nice pressing. Recommended. -
Edited 3 years agoDuring the 1983-85 period Robert Smith was experimenting with hitting new notes it seemed on every new song. Using his voice to accent and accentuate emotion. Sometimes in a fun an playful way and sometimes like these, in serious and very unique way. And here is the culmination of that in New Day and Stop Dead. 2 underated b-sides in their discography...
